The Seychelles is participating in a climate change hearing at the International Court of Justice
The Seychelles is attending a climate change hearing at the International Court of Justice in
The International Court of Justice has revised its oral argument schedule for an advisory opinion
The 9th Handle Climate Change Film Festival honored exemplary films on climate change during COP29,